Pros

wonderful children, room for small growth

Cons

they schedule you for a ten hour day and say they will give you an hour and a half break... which is long... but its whatever... however this never happens and suddenly at the end of the week you have a three hour break... very frusterating... however the biggest downfall is management... they are all trained and have all been a teacher in the past.. however they are the most disrespectful people i have ever met... they always complain and never give positive feedback... they will come and complain bout things that are not your fault... they are constantly moving children around so you never really know what are going into at the begining of the day... they always make you stay late and you will never hear a thank you... i would never recommend this job... and they always wnder why people quit all the time

Pros

The kids and families are amazing. It’s so rewarding to go into work and watch a baby learn to walk or a toddler begin to learn their colors and know that I had a part in that. Watching the kids grow and learn was the absolute best part of the job.

Cons

There were a lot of safety concerns. Staff were not all held to the same standard and children were getting hurt because some staff were allowed to slack while others weren’t. I was both parent and staff. My concerns about safety were brushed off by my admin and the district as well. There was favoritism and a lack of training. The pay is also very low. The CEO has never been on the classroom side of childcare and that tells you everything you need to know.
